The two policemen who escaped and were re-arrested for the failed robbery of GCB Bank bullion van at Maame Krobo in the Afram Plains area of the Eastern Region have been remanded by an Accra Magistrate Court.

The two, Corporal Elvis Mensah and Lance Corporal Daniel Kissi,  were arrested following their attempted robbery which led to the death of the van driver, David Kofi Sarpong, aged 52, but escaped a day later when they were being transported to the Eastern regional Police command in Koforidua.

They were later re-arrested, transported to Accra and have been charged with conspiracy to commit a crime, and murder.

Their escape led to clashes between the police and angry residents in the Afram Plains area, who alleged that the Police allowed the suspects to escape and went on rampage destroying police property and threatening the lives of police officers.

The vandalism led the Inspector General of Police (IGP), John Kudalor to announced a withdrawal of police personnel from the area until the residents help to fix the vandalised stations.
